Spécifications
| Attribut | Valeur |
| Series | HotRod™ |
| Part Status | Active |
| Type | Non-Isolated PoL Module |
| Number of Outputs | 1 |
| Voltage - Input (Min) | 4.2V |
| Voltage - Input (Max) | 60V |
| Voltage - Output 1 | 1 ~ 6V |
| Current - Output (Max) | 1.5A |
| Power (Watts) | 9 W |
| Applications | ITE (Commercial) |
| Features | Adjustable Output, Standby Output |
| Operating Temperature | -40°C ~ 125°C |
| Efficiency | 86% |
| Mounting Type | Surface Mount |
| Package / Case | 15-PowerBQFN Module |
| Size / Dimension | 0.20" L x 0.22" W x 0.16" H (5.0mm x 5.5mm x 4.1mm) |
| Supplier Device Package | 15-B3QFN (5x5.5) |

Description
Key features of the TPSM5601R5RDAR include a wide input voltage range, typically 4.2V to 60V, and a selectable output voltage of up to 99% of the input voltage. It offers a continuous output current of up to 1.5A, making it suitable for various applications, including industrial, automotive, and communication equipment.
The module is equipped with protection features such as thermal shutdown, current limit, and undervoltage lockout, ensuring reliable operation under different conditions. Its compact design, in a QFN package, facilitates easy integration into various PCB layouts, offering a robust solution for space-constrained applications that require high efficiency and reliability.
